The training begins with the Navy's recruit boot camp, followed by a two-month preparatory course, a three-week orientation at the Naval Special Warfare Center in Coronado, California and seven weeks of physical conditioning and learning navigation and water skills. Naval Amphibious Base (NAB) Coronado - GlobalSecurity.org NAB is approximately 1,000 acres in size and is composed of the Main Base, training beaches, California least tern preserve, recreational marina, enlisted family housing, and state park. The center restarted paused portions of its SEAL and special warfare combatant-craft crewman selection-and-assessment training following careful planning that included implementing COVID-19 mitigation efforts based on recommendations from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and Defense Department medical guidance. Keith Davids, the head of Naval Special Warfare Command, made the decision to move-up the already scheduled turnover of these two leaders to meet the needs of the organization and properly focus on the remaining issues identified by the Naval Education and Training Command (NETC) investigation into the (Centers) supervision of Basic Underwater Demolition/SEAL (BUD/S) Class 352, the command said in a statement issued Tuesday.
